As nouns, Babinski sign is a hyponym of reflex response; that is, Babinski sign is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than reflex response:
  • reflex response: an automatic instinctive unlearned reaction to a stimulus
  • Babinski sign: extension upward of the toes when the sole of the foot is stroked firmly on the outer side from the heel to the front; normal in infants under the age of two years but a sign of brain or spinal cord injury in older persons
